As you explore the menu, your taste buds will be tantalized by a variety of appetizing offerings, each crafted with care and precision.
- Baba Ganooj: A standout dish made from baked eggplant, pureed to perfection with tahini, garlic, and lemon. Topped with olive oil and served with warm pita bread, this dish is an absolute must-try at just $5.95.
- Dolma: For those who love delicate flavors, the tender grape leaves stuffed with a savory mix of rice and spices, served with tzatziki sauce at $5.45, offer a delightful start to your meal.
- Harira Soup and Salad: Dive into a bowl of warmth with this rich soup paired with your choice of either Greek or tabouli salad for just $9.95, perfect for those cooler days.
